This article is a guide to identifying several types of acorn-producing trees. Additionally, oak tree acorns are a valuable food source for wildlife, giving them nourishment during winter months. When prepared correctly, the acorns from many oak trees have a sweet, buttery taste. Trees that produce acorns are valuable shade trees that also produce edible nuts. These acorn-producing trees are easily identified in the landscape due to their characteristic lobed oak leaves, large, spreading canopy, and brown nuts nestling in a small wart cap - the easily recognizable acorns.
